The Black Consciousness Movement was a movement of grassroots anti-Apartheid activist that emerged in South Africa in the mid-1960s. This movement was created by the jailing and banning of the African National Congress and Pan Africanist Congress leadership after the happening of  Sharpeville Massacre in the year 1960. Stephen Bantu Biko who was a student who started this movement. The main purpose of Black Consciousness Movement was to increase Black self-awareness and in order to unite Black students, professionals, and intellectuals.

True or False. Agrarian and slave states would not sign the Constitution unless the Slave & Trade Act & 3/5ths Compromise was added to it.

Answers

Answer: True

Explanation:

The Slave and Trade Act was an Act that Congress wanted to pass to stop the importation of enslaved people from outside the country as a first step to limiting slavery. The South wanted to delay this for more than a decade.

The 3/5ths Clause allowed for the counting of every 5 enslaved people as 3 people for the purposes of representation in the House of Representatives.

Southern states such as Georgia and North and South Carolina refused to sign the Constitution unless the above were added to protect their slaveholding policies.

The Truman Doctrine was a piece of foreign policy legislation that was a response to the rise of Soviet Russia and communism post World War II. Its aim was to  prevent the spread of communism to free nations, or nations that were still suffering from the effects of the war. The U.S. saw the evils of communism and how it would take an already destroyed nation and plunge it into utter chaos. So they pledged political, economic, and even military assistance to nations who were susceptible to the rise of foreign or domestic authoritarian forces looking to use communism as their trojan horse to power. All of this was in an effort to contain communism to the nations it had already consumed (USSR, China, North Korea, etc.)

1. Why was the American public unaware of the genocide occuring in Germany in the 1930’s?

Answers

Few are as aware that the news is the first draft of history as is the team behind a recently opened exhibition at the United States Holocaust Memorial Museum (USHMM). To put together Americans and the Holocaust, they combed through the German news column in more than a decade’s worth of issues of TIME magazine — and parallel sections from many other magazines and newspapers — and what they found refuted a persistent, though oft-debunked, myth about World War II and the Holocaust: the idea that, as the museum puts it, “Americans lacked access to information about the persecution of Jews as it was happening.”

Looking at the news that publications like TIME ran in the 1930s and ’40s shows that, in fact, Americans had lots of access to news about what was happening to Europe’s Jewish population and others targeted by the Nazi regime. But it also highlights a central truth about this period — and human beings in general. Reading or hearing something is not the same as understanding what it truly means, curator Daniel Greene tells TIME, and there’s a wide “gap between information and understanding.”

Case in point: Dr. Paul Joseph Goebbels, Nazi propaganda minister, on the cover of the July 10, 1933, issue of TIME Magazine, from 85 years ago this Tuesday.

Though TIME’s 1933 article, about Hitler’s new cabinet, didn’t yet treat Hitler with complete seriousness — he was referred to as a “Vegetarian Superman” — it didn’t pull punches on the ideas behind his ascent. The article presented as fact that the consolidation of Nazi rule had lifted the spirit of the German people, even as the world watched warily, and explained that one tactic above all was helping Hitler and Goebbels with that uplift: “explaining away all Germany’s defeats and trials in terms of the Jew.”

It would have been impossible to read the story and miss the danger Hitler presented to his country’s Jewish citizens:

True Germans were not defeated in the War, so runs the Nazi tale for grown-up children. They were betrayed by Jewish pacifists. Marx was a Jew! In the welter of German revolution the Jews fomented a German Republic essentially Marxist. Under inflation “which only the Jews understood,” they bled true Germans white by their scheming speculation. Somehow or other they had something to do with the mountain of debt the Allies piled on Germany. All these “facts” are profoundly important in the Germany of today. They are at the root of national resurgence. By blaming everything on their Jewish fellow men, other Germans are escaping from their mental prison of inferiority. Louder and louder the Minister of Propaganda dins with clenched and pounding fists the exhortation he has thundered from half the platforms and over all the radios in Germany: “Never forget it, comrades, and repeat it a hundred times so you will say it in your dreams—”THE JEWS ARE TO BLAME!”

The two ways a bill can be killed are not reporting the bill to the floor and no reconciliation of the two versions of bill by the two committe.

To make a law come to pass, a bill has to go through various process. In these processes, there are ways that can kill the bill also. The first one is, when the bill is not reported to the floor. When a bill will not be reported to the floor, there will be no debate or consideration done over the bill. Thus, killing the bill.

The other ways is when the two committees cannot reconcile its two versions. The House and the Senate, both, present their version of the bill to the president, if two versions do not reconcile, it can kill the bill.

What was the Treaty of Versailles?

This was a Treaty signed with Germany after WWI. It imposed restrictive covenants on Germany such as the demilitarization of the Rhine and the forbidding of an Anschluss with Austria.

When Hitler broke these covenants in the 1930s, he was in violation of the treaty but wasn't punished.

The United Nations (UN) was created at the end of World War II as an international peacekeeping organization and a forum for resolving conflicts between nations.

The UN replaced the ineffective League of Nations, which had failed to prevent the outbreak of the Second World War.

The UN was established on October 24, 1945, with headquarters in Manhattan, New York City, and reflected the rise of the United States to global leadership in the postwar period.
